If we're talking center, I think JMS and Tipmmann are the first two off the board.

You can cross your fingers and hope that Wypler is there at 74, but even if he is, I don't see Berry drafting a center that high--especially after what we just signed Pocic to.

If you want to look at realistic center targets, Stromberg and Juice Scruggs stand out to me as later round guys we might be able to target. I like Olusegun, but his age and athletic scores might take him out of our front office's sights.

I pray that we do not end up with Karl Brooks.

If he ends up being a good pro, I’ll be entirely shocked. Watched so much of him, and just couldn’t want to stay further away. Good pass rusher for his size. Not great anchor against the run at any tech he’ll play.

I had the pleasure of watching Chris Jones at BG, and a lot of BG people comp them. CJ was 10x the talent and he was nothing more than a JAG.
